Product Description:
(1-Isobutyl-1H-pyrazol-5-yl)boronic acid is primarily used in organic synthesis, particularly in Suzuki-Miyaura cross-coupling reactions. This reaction is widely employed in the pharmaceutical industry to create carbon-carbon bonds, which are essential for constructing complex molecules, including drug candidates. The boronic acid group in the compound acts as a key reagent, enabling the formation of biaryl structures, which are common in many active pharmaceutical ingredients (APIs). Additionally, it finds applications in material science for the development of organic electronic materials, such as polymers and small molecules used in organic light-emitting diodes (OLEDs) and other optoelectronic devices. Its versatility and stability make it a valuable tool in modern synthetic chemistry.
